 Algerian Cultural Week Will Be Held in Tehran

Algerian cultural week will be held in Tehran on Monday, December 12 with the contribution of the Islamic Culture and Relations Organization, AVA Diplomatic reports.

According to the Public Relations of Islamic Culture and Relations Organization, Algerian cultural week will be held in Tehran on Monday, December 12 with the presence of Algerian artists from the fields of cinema, music, handicrafts and visual arts.

The aim of this cultural event is to introduce the culture and arts of Algerian people to Iranians which will be held in the form of poetry night, the establishment of arts and handicrafts exhibition, broadcast film, performance of traditional and ritual music, and academic meetings in the field of cultural relations between the two countries.

According to this report, Abdel-Monem Ahriz, Algerian Ambassador to Iran and the diplomatic members of the Algerian Embassy met with Seyed Mohammad Hossein Hashemi, the Cultural Deputy of the Islamic Culture and Relations Organization in the Islamic Culture and Relations Organization to carry out the necessary coordination to hold this cultural event.

It is noteworthy that Iranian Cultural Week was held in Algeria on October 2015 with the presence of Dr. Abouzar Ebrahimi Torkaman, the head of the Islamic Culture and Relations Organization and his accompanying delegation.
